Output 37076c289586ebb040f51e422807fb9e6d35c7ba4d9001584dc216f178604189:99

value
2145577
script pubkey
OP_0 OP_PUSHBYTES_20 65bca55aee44feaf30d497c1ba59364b7f30a84f
address
bc1qvk722khwgnl27vx5jlqm5kfkfdlnp2z0w8lv3c
transaction
37076c289586ebb040f51e422807fb9e6d35c7ba4d9001584dc216f178604189
spent
true